I have a Sweet Chinese Lemon adjacent to a 6 foot chain link fence, The
tree, always loaded with fruit, is 3 to 4 feet wide with a span of about 30
feet and a height of 6 to 7 feet tall. It makes a perfect, totally
impervious barrier. The same effect could be accomplished with many citrus
varieties with minimal work. I would be glar to show you.
